InfiniteMac OSx86

InfiniteMac OSx86 (http://infinitemac.com/forum.php)
-   Snow Leopard 10.6 (http://infinitemac.com/forumdisplay.php?f=87)
-   -   [AMD] Snow Leopard 10A432 Install (http://infinitemac.com/showthread.php?t=3727)

macxuser33 08-23-2009 10:33 AM

Well i got it up and running , dont have any ide and only the 1 usb ports seems ot be workling so had to connect mouse & k`board to the usb hub on the 1st port other than seems ok

macxuser33 08-23-2009 10:54 AM

Quote:

Originally Posted by aryajuanda (Post 31833)
its a legacy kernel.. haven't tested on pentium D... (i dont have one) may be you should try it to find out..

Kernel works fine on intel ( Pentium D )

pαuℓzurrr. 08-23-2009 11:07 AM

I think its best to wait till Snow Leopard is officially released, after that there will be more kernels/kexts/bootloaders...

modbin 08-23-2009 03:53 PM

Quote:

Originally Posted by maya77 (Post 31849)
This is disaster.

Do you know if Dmitrik's kernel supports on the fly patching?

About binpatched kernel and source modded kernel:

on the fly patcher requires a kernel source from apple and a huge workaround. Since apple did not release 10.6 kernel sources yet, the only way to make the kernel work on amd is to modify it with a hexeditor. eg take the original kernel and patch it. A binpatched kernel will never support the "on the fly cpuid patcher". Itīs not possible!

greets,
modbin ;)

aryajuanda 08-23-2009 06:09 PM

welcome at board modbin.... thx for your kernel.... :D

maya77 08-23-2009 07:37 PM

Quote:

Originally Posted by modbin (Post 31922)
About binpatched kernel and source modded kernel:

on the fly patcher requires a kernel source from apple and a huge workaround. Since apple did not release 10.6 kernel sources yet, the only way to make the kernel work on amd is to modify it with a hexeditor. eg take the original kernel and patch it. A binpatched kernel will never support the "on the fly cpuid patcher". Itīs not possible!

greets,
modbin ;)

I'm glad to see you here. Really. :-)

And thanks for explanation.

This may be stupid question, but is there a way to make 10.0.0 kernel from 9.8.0 source?

Patch 9.8 kernel for SL instead of patching 10.0 kernel for AMD?

SL is almost useless on AMD without on-the-fly opcode patching. SSE3 emulation and 64-bit support on AMD are also important parts of Voodoo kernel.

pαuℓzurrr. 08-23-2009 08:41 PM

@maya77, just give it some days/weeks ;)
Once the sources are out im sure someone will make a new kernel with opcode patching :)

charlienail 08-24-2009 05:53 AM

problem with 9600 gt
 
hey, so i've installed 10a432 on my friends hackintosh gigabyte p45udl. he has a 9600gt with 1024mb of ram. we got the bootup, sata, sound and networking working but can't get the video working.
i've tried creating a custom efi string with osx86 tools and putting it in boot.plis with the name, 1024mb ram and dvi-dvi. but no luck. i've also tried editing nvdav50hal.kext and nvdaresman.kext to put in the devid in the info.plist.

how did you get your 9600gt working? all you did was the efi string? how did you generate it? do you have any injectors? on leopard (5.7) his card works fine with nvdarwin injector.

i thought this card would be easy to install but efi studio and acpi patcher do not have prebuilt efi strings for it. the card is actually dvi,vga and hdmi i think but we'd be happy with just the dvi working.
thanks for your help

aryajuanda 08-24-2009 07:53 AM

Quote:

Originally Posted by charlienail (Post 32004)
hey, so i've installed 10a432 on my friends hackintosh gigabyte p45udl. he has a 9600gt with 1024mb of ram. we got the bootup, sata, sound and networking working but can't get the video working.
i've tried creating a custom efi string with osx86 tools and putting it in boot.plis with the name, 1024mb ram and dvi-dvi. but no luck. i've also tried editing nvdav50hal.kext and nvdaresman.kext to put in the devid in the info.plist.

how did you get your 9600gt working? all you did was the efi string? how did you generate it? do you have any injectors? on leopard (5.7) his card works fine with nvdarwin injector.

i thought this card would be easy to install but efi studio and acpi patcher do not have prebuilt efi strings for it. the card is actually dvi,vga and hdmi i think but we'd be happy with just the dvi working.
thanks for your help

yes i use efi string t get my VGA working... just generate it with GFX tools in osx86tools or maybe u can use silent natit 64 bit for snow to inject your vga ..
if u use 32 bit mode some injector still working

george205 08-24-2009 04:30 PM

Maybe another silly idea or....?
 
Ok! This may be another silly idea. But would it be possible to load a cpuid patcher/simulator from a bootloader just before loading mach_kernel? I don't know if this would be possible as I'm not a programmer, but I was thinking QEMU, which can even simulate lots of non-intel cpu architectures using intel/amd cpus. I know tha QEMU is an open-sourced program that needs to be loaded UNDER an os in order to be used but.....
If there could be something like that, all amd users could run unmodified vanilla kernels. So I would like to have an answer from people who have the appropriate knowledge on programming.

About my system:
Motherboard: Supermicro H8DAE-2 with nVidia MCP55 Pro chipset which supports up to two Six-Core AMD Opteron 2000/8000 processors
Super Micro Computer, Inc. - Aplus Products | Motherboards | H8DAE-2
Processor: 1x Opteron 8214 (for the time being) :-)
Ram: 4 GB Samsung DDR2 667 Registered ECC Unbuffered
Graphics Card: Nvidia 9400 GT
I also have two SATA hard disks, 120 GB and 640GB , a Sony IDE DVD reader and an Optiarc DVD Recorder.